Legitimacy in the crypto sector refers to a platform’s compliance with regulations, transparency in operations, and robust security protocols. For Stock X, users often seek proof of regulatory registration, clear company information, and a transparent fee structure. As of June 2024, the crypto industry has seen a rise in regulatory scrutiny, with global authorities tightening requirements for exchanges and trading platforms. According to a Cointelegraph report dated June 10, 2024, over 60% of leading crypto platforms have updated their compliance frameworks in the past year to meet new standards.
